Remote NFP Audit Manager | Boutique Independent CPA Firm | Up to $150k + Bonus

Location: 100% Remote

Compensation: Up to $150,000 base + annual bonus

Requirements: 5+ years NFP audit experience | Private foundation experience required | CPA required


About Us

We are a boutique, independently owned CPA firm based in California — with decades of history built exclusively around nonprofit organizations. This is not a generalist firm with an NFP practice. Every client we serve, every engagement we run, and every professional on our team is focused entirely on the nonprofit sector. Private foundations and a wide range of nonprofit entity types across multiple sectors.


We are in active growth mode — new managing leadership is in place, the client base is expanding, and we are hiring an NFP Audit Manager to grow with us. This is a ground floor opportunity with a clear path to Partner for the right person.


The Opportunity

As an Audit Manager, you will lead nonprofit audit engagements from planning through issuance — serving as the primary client relationship owner and a key member of a small, high-performing team. This is not a role where you manage the work while someone else owns the client. You are the relationship — and leadership will invest in you accordingly.


What You Will Do

  • Lead and manage NFP audit engagements across a wide range of nonprofit entity types — from planning through issuance
  • Serve as the primary client relationship owner on active engagements
  • Review workpapers, financial statements, and audit reports for accuracy and compliance
  • Mentor and develop senior associates and staff
  • Collaborate directly with managing partners on client strategy and firm growth initiatives
  • Stay current on nonprofit accounting standards, GAAP, and evolving compliance requirements
  • Contribute to firm-wide growth initiatives as the practice expands under new leadership

What We Are Looking For

  • Active CPA required
  • 5+ years of NFP audit experience — this must be the majority of your background, not something you do occasionally
  • Private foundation experience required — this is the core of the role
  • Experience managing audit engagements end-to-end and supervising audit staff
  • Comfortable serving as primary client contact on active engagements
  • Previous remote work experience strongly preferred
  • Stable tenure at prior firms — commitment and consistency matter here



What We Offer

  • Base salary up to $150,000, commensurate with experience
  • Annual bonus
  • Unlimited PTO — and a culture that encourages you to use it
  • 401(k) — 3% employer match
  • Medical, dental, and vision — 50% of employee premiums covered by the firm
  • Fully remote with flexible schedule
  • No micromanagement — real autonomy from day one
  • Clear path to Partner as the firm grows under new leadership
